The Oklahoma City housing market has a median home price of $264,000, down 1.9% year-over-year. Homes are spending an average of 52 days on the market. For homeowners who purchased in the last 3โ€“5 years, equity has built up โ€” equity that can be accessed through a sale-leaseback without the disruption of moving.

How does a sale-leaseback work in Oklahoma?

You sell your home to a vetted investor and sign a lease to stay as a renter. Closing takes 30-45 days, lease terms range 1-5 years. You get your equity as cash and eliminate ownership costs like ~$1,700/yr/year in taxes and $4,700/yr in insurance.
